All places in the state related to Lord Krishna will be developed as pilgrimage sites: CM Dr. Yadav
10-Jan-2025 12:00 AM 490

Chief Minister Dr. Mohan Yadav stated that under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i’s leadership, the celebration of cultural traditions continues uninterrupted. He announced plans to develop all sites in Madhya Pradesh associated with Lord Krishna as pilgrimage destinations. Dr. Yadav shared these views while speaking to the media after visiting Lord Krishna’s birthplace in Mathura with his family. Chief Minister Dr. Mohan Yadav highlighted the spiritual significance of Madhya Pradesh, noting that many events from Lord Krishna’s life—such as his social welfare activities, education, friendship, and receiving the Sudarshan Chakra from Lord Parshuram—occurred on its land. He announced plans to develop these sites as pilgrimage destinations, aligning with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i’s commitment to promoting religious tourism. Dr. Yadav expressed confidence that these pilgrimages would become centers of faith and attraction for Lord Krishna’s followers worldwide. He also mentioned that the state government had organized grand celebrations for Govardhan Puja and Gita Jayanti this year and would ensure Janmashtami is celebrated with similar enthusiasm.
